I agree with most people on this thread that the Skins will finish in the top 2 of the EAST...I also believe we will be in the toughest division in the league again this year...meaning we will be battle tested again for the playoff run....I also agree that we a REAL shot at the SB these next two years, especialy if Campbell steps in and there's no hickups at QB....Knowing Snyders style, i'm sure we will pick up another WR and add to our deffense...With out additions to our team, this is where i see we are up on all the other teams in our division and where some other teams are up on us:

Coaching:Redkins, Easy Pick
Secondary:Redskins (if Taylor is FREE)-Philly, VERY close
LB's:Redskins (with or without Lavar), if we lose Lavar Philly would be closer
DLine: NY Giants
QB: Eagles
RB: Skins slight edge over NY, even though I love Portis...you can't knock Tiki
WR: Giants, just because they are deeper...not better
TE: Giants, just because Cooley is a H-back and not a TRUE TE...
O-Line: Redskins, just ask the Giants
FB/H-back: Cooley and Sellers, do I have to say more?????????

I would love to say we will win the east, but realisticly I can't do that...just because I don't know which Brunnell will show up next year, and if Campbell will be ready.....What do you guys think about??????????????

I agree the NFC EAST is is back I love that not only that the Hole NFC is starting to look like contender that they where missing from previous years.

This will be again the tougher division in the NFL all 4 teams are playoff contenders in paper right now and could easily beat any of the other teams. Heck in this SB you beat Seattle and we had them beat and all the players are saying we were the toughest team they played heck we were the only team to held them to less than 300 yards and alexander to less than 70 ( not counting philly game because they where losing 42 -0 and took alexander out in halftime), we beet the other division final Carolina and almost beat Denver so that tells me we're contender.

Right now it's to early to tell wich team will be on top we all have some holes to fill (us more) and have to see how FA and draft goes but I can see any teamgoing long next year it all come down to division victorys.

right know you have made the best offseason moves than any team resigning williams and signing Saunders wow 3 Head coaches in 1 team

right now I will rank the team as how I feel them at this point.

1.- Redskins
2.- Phi
3.- Cowboys
4.- NYG

Biggest Concerns

Redskins
QB.- brunnell was looking tired at the end of the season not making enough plays and it showed in both playoffs games and he's going 2 be 1 year older and I don't know if campbell is ready to take over and if he is I don't believe he could take you deaph in the playoffs--- best chance rigt now to make a run to the SB is Brunell if he has a good season.

WR.- you dont have a sure #2 and I know some said pick up Antwan but he's like Moss a speed receiver and you need a good posesion receiver. I don't like the idea 1 bit if you pic TO (I don't think you have the cap but its scary) even though he might only help 1 year it he might help you get 2 the SB

Oline- depth when you lost your starting line it showed.

Cap.- you have huge cap problems we need 2 see who is let go, or who is traded.

Arlington.- he bring a different dimension to the D you can say all you want about his free style or anything but he is a playmaker ad has hearth and passion in the field and the d just look different without him.

..............
secondary points
Draft ( you don't have a 1st and lets see what you can get in the 2nd)

3 capable HC in the staff this sound great should be great but an also hurth if they can control their own egos (not 2 worried about williams ) gibbs Saunders 2 offensive gurus with different aproaches 2 the offense lets see how it pans out ( but hey they said Jones and Parcell wouldt get along and we allready have 3 years under the belth).

CB and SS you need at least 1 of each 1 to be the nickel corner and 1 to be alongside Taylor.

PHI

Coaching staff.- they lost their Offensive coordinator lets see how they adapt to the change it hurth NE it can hurth PHI

WR.- they need a #1 and #2 and #3 (lol) receiver this is the worst receving corps in the nfl.

QB.- Mcnabb needs to stay healthy the hole season (they deppend completly on him)

Oline.- they have huge problems at Guard



secondary points.....
the hole loker room is divided with the TO deal a lot of them support TO and don't support Mcnaab that hurst the chemestry and it get reflected on the field.

RB.- Im just no Westbrook fan good rb comming as a receiver but not so good rb

Dline they are getting old and don't have depth.

Cowboys

Oline.- we have huge problems here and it showed once F.Adams went down the offense was totally different after that you just need to see the first PHI,NY,WAS meeting and the next meeting he cant get hurth and we need a Guard, RT and Center either the young guys step up or get veteran help.

FS.- this is a must we have 3 good SS but no FS and have huge problems with coverage and deep balls

LB.- we need at least 2 Qualitty lb we change to the 3-4 but don't have depth we have Ware and B.James who are rally good , a 2nd round pick Burnnet from last year but almost didn't play and (fujita and shanle that aren't really starter material).

Secondary points.
Bledsoe.- needs protection and needs to stay healthy no real backup after him

O-coordinator.- Palmer don't know what he'll bring but I guess Parcell will still be calling the shots so that means we need good defense.

Rb.- consistency out of Julius Jones he has shown flashes of greatness but 2 many injuries and some bad games also related to the o-line

pick veteran help.- we have over 10 mill on the cap need to bring some help we an't have another year with 5 rookies playing prominet roles and 4 1st year starters

Wr.- need to get younger the top 2 can still produce but need some fresh legs to spread the field


NYG

Sencondary.- they have the worst secondary in the division to many holes here.

LB.- only 2 capable LB not a lot of dept

Oline.- need help at guard

Wr.- more dept Plaxico has turn great Ike is a servicible 2 (more like a 3rd) but not real dept after that.

Seconday points.

QB.- it depend if Eli steps up or still get cold feet with the presure this team will go as far as he can take it he has ha dgreat games but to many awfull performances.

DE.- Strahan is getting old and if he can't perform at the top level their pass rush is going to be affected tremendously he's the lider on that group we saw 2 years ago what happend when he went down.

RB.- Jacobs has to step up and be the power runner he was drafted 2 be
